Transaction 58f6083d3f44aee24336747bb5f108b5e8fc3de8dc1982a90aeaed40ec63ad5b
1 Input
1 Output
-
58f6083d3f44aee24336747bb5f108b5e8fc3de8dc1982a90aeaed40ec63ad5b:0
- value
- 23301
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 aae3d084faf9412d0699d753caf4a26135501cfb61c536faeac4db9d53d4250c
- address
- bc1p4t3app86l9qj6p5e6afu4a9zvy64q88mv8znd7h2cnde6575y5xqrfuky5